2 Cars Stolen In Bloomfield; Left Running With Keys Inside: PD

Vehicles were stolen on Ridge Avenue and a 7-Eleven in Bloomfield. Both were left running with the keys inside, police said.

BLOOMFIELD, NJ — A pair of vehicles were recently stolen on Ridge Avenue and a local 7-Eleven in Bloomfield. Both were left running with the keys inside, police said.

The Bloomfield Police Department released the following statements about each theft:

Nov. 15 – “Officers responded to 122 Bloomfield Avenue (7-Eleven) on a report of a stolen auto. The owner of the vehicle parked her blue 2021 Honda CRV running with the keys inside. While she was inside the establishment, she observed an unidentified male exit a gray, two-door Acura TL. The suspect then gets into her vehicle and flees east on Bloomfield Avenue. This vehicle was entered NCIC stolen. This incident is under investigation.”

Nov. 21 – “Officers responded to Ridge Avenue on report of a stolen motor vehicle. The owner of the vehicle left his silver 2008 Honda CRV running with the keys inside. While he was inside his friend’s residence for approximately 17 minutes, an unidentified male who exited a blue, older-model Honda Civic entered his vehicle and fled the scene on Ridge Avenue. This vehicle was entered NCIC stolen. This incident is under investigation.”
